Up-regulation of BTLA expression in myeloid dendritic cells in neonatal sepsis associated with the treatment outcome and down-regulation of DC function

<title>Abstract</title> <p>Background: Neonatal sepsis is an acute life-threatening condition in neonates, and a proper innate inflammatory is essential for prevention of the systemic inflammation associated with sepsis.
